The structural, elastic and electronic properties of quaternary intermetallic compounds η-Cu4.5Ni1Au0.5Sn5 and η-Cu5Ni1Sn4.5In0.5 are investigated by an ab initio method. The calculated heat of formation determines preferential occupancy sites for Ni, Au and In atoms which lead to thermodynamically stable compounds.
